Summary

SEC Mike Bratton (@MichaelWBratton) and his Cousin Shane (@BigOrangeVolz) recap Day 1 of SEC Spring Meetings SEC on CBS announces first game of the 2023 season (1:50), guessing the SEC on CBS doubleheaders (5:30), how the SEC scheduling format will look if the league votes to stay at 8 games (10:00), Nick Saban on SEC scheduling format and latest NIL complaints (14:00), Eli Drinkwitz’s went viral after his comments were taken out of context and he explains why the SEC should go to 9 games (26:00), why Kirby Smart got it wrong when he says the 8 versus 9-game debate is “the most overrated conversation there ever was” (40:50), Hugh Freeze on playing Georgia annually and trying to fix tampering (46:00), Jimbo Fisher gave the perfect answer when asked about Texas wanting to play Oklahoma annually (54:30) Advertising inquiries: thatsecpodcast@gmail.com Call In Line: (615) 965-5152 All show music comes via Nashville band Crimson Calamity; check out their work by clicking the link below:  https://open.spotify.com/artist/29HGeJEcYHBJlyt4xIcLBw?si=GJoEOr0YSoeqWkrjhCc0Ug Donate to cousin Shane’s beer fund via CashApp: $thatSECpodcast We have t-shirts for sale!
